Abstract :
The small-signal dynamics of the phase-shifted full bridge DC/DC power converter is described with the aid of the computer program FREDOMSIM. The inherent inner feedback loop is open and the circuit is modeled as the connection of a snubbered full bridge with an output low pass filter, providing a third order system. The procedure looks suitable for modeling other switching topologies, mainly those proposing particular difficulties to their analysis.
